SNOHOMISH CITY OF is one of 111 community water systems in Washington in the 10,001 to 100,000 people size category, serving 16,367 people from surface water.
As of August 1, 2026, its federal record holds 24 entries between 1992 and 2012, all of which EPA lists as closed. Nothing has been added since 2012.
Of the 24, 23 are monitoring and reporting requirements — the category that accounts for about four in five of all violations in EPA's national dataset — rather than findings about the water itself. The record involves volatile organic chemicals, the Surface Water Treatment Rules, and the Total Coliform Rules.

Common questions
Is SNOHOMISH CITY OF required to publish a Consumer Confidence Report?
- Yes. SNOHOMISH CITY OF is a community water system, and federal rules (40 CFR 141 Subpart O) require every community water system to publish a Consumer Confidence Report each year.
When is SNOHOMISH CITY OF’s next Consumer Confidence Report due?
- SNOHOMISH CITY OF’s next Consumer Confidence Report is due by July 1, 2027. The report covers calendar year 2026.
Does SNOHOMISH CITY OF have any open drinking water violations on record?
- As of August 1, 2026, EPA's federal records show no open violations for SNOHOMISH CITY OF.
What is a Consumer Confidence Report?
- A Consumer Confidence Report (CCR) is the annual drinking water quality report that community water systems must provide to the people they serve. It lists the contaminants detected in the system’s water during the year, where the water comes from, and how the results compare with federal limits. EPA’s revised CCR rule takes effect January 1, 2027, and the first reports in the new format are due July 1, 2027.
